1. August 1st Uprising Memorial Hall

The August 1st Uprising Memorial Hall is one of the iconic attractions in Nanchang. Located in the center of Nanchang. This is the memorial site of the first armed uprising led by the Communist Party of China and the birthplace of the Chinese People's Liberation Army. In the memorial hall, you can learn about the historical background and significance of the August 1st Uprising, visit revolutionary cultural relics and exhibitions, and experience the arduous and outstanding revolutionary years.

3. Nanchang Tengwang Pavilion

Nanchang Tengwang Pavilion is an ancient pavilion located in Tengwang Pavilion Park. This attic was built in the Tang Dynasty and is one of the oldest existing wooden structure pavilions in China. Climbing up to Tengwang Pavilion, you can overlook the beautiful scenery of the entire Nanchang city and feel the charm of ancient buildings.
